117.info
人生若只如初见

java数据库框架有哪些优点

Java数据库框架有以下优点:

  1. 简化数据库操作:Java数据库框架能够提供简单而直接的API,使得开发人员能够以更少的代码完成数据库操作。它们通常提供了ORM(对象关系映射)功能,将数据库表和Java对象进行映射,使得开发人员能够以面向对象的方式操作数据库。

  2. 提高开发效率:Java数据库框架提供了很多功能强大的工具和库,如数据连接池、事务管理等,可以帮助开发人员更高效地开发数据库相关的应用程序。

  3. 具有良好的性能:Java数据库框架通常对数据库连接、缓存、查询优化等方面进行了优化,能够提供较高的性能。同时,它们也支持批量插入、批量更新等操作,进一步提升性能。

  4. 跨数据库平台:Java数据库框架通常支持多种数据库,如MySQL、Oracle、SQL Server等,可以在不同的数据库平台上运行。这使得开发人员可以在不同的项目中使用同一套框架,减少了对特定数据库的依赖。

  5. 提供更好的安全性:Java数据库框架通常提供了对SQL注入等安全问题的防护措施,能够有效地保护数据库的安全性。

  6. 提供了复杂查询和关联查询的支持:Java数据库框架通常提供了强大的查询功能,能够以面向对象的方式进行复杂查询和关联查询。

总之,Java数据库框架具有简化数据库操作、提高开发效率、良好的性能、跨数据库平台、提供更好的安全性等优点,使得开发人员能够更轻松地进行数据库开发。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e490AzsLBABVBVQ.html

推荐文章

  • java项目访问不到数据库的表如何解决

    如果 Java 项目无法访问数据库表,可能有以下几个原因和解决方法: 数据库连接配置问题:检查数据库连接配置是否正确,包括数据库的 URL、用户名、密码等信息。确...

  • java怎么获取数据库表字段

    要获取数据库表字段,可以使用Java的JDBC(Java Database Connectivity)接口和SQL语句来实现。首先,需要连接到数据库并创建一个连接对象。可以使用`DriverMana...

  • java怎么监听数据库表数据变化

    在Java中监听数据库表数据变化可以通过以下几种方式实现:1. 使用JDBC的数据库触发器:使用JDBC连接数据库,注册相应的触发器,当数据库表数据发生变化时,触发器...

  • java怎么获取数据库元数据

    在Java中,可以使用JDBC(Java Database Connectivity)来获取数据库的元数据。以下是一些示例代码,演示如何获取数据库元数据:```javaimport java.sql.Connect...

  • 云服务器显示增强配置的方法是什么

    要显示云服务器的增强配置,可以通过以下方法: 登录云服务器控制台:打开云服务器提供商的控制台,使用您的账号和密码登录。 选择云服务器实例:在控制台首页或...

  • ORM框架中EntityFramework的作用是什么

    EntityFramework是一种ORM(对象关系映射)框架,用于将关系型数据库中的数据映射到面向对象的模型中。它允许开发人员通过编写类和属性来表示数据库中的表和列,...

  • SpringBoot中HttpSession的作用是什么

    在Spring Boot中,HttpSession是用于在Web应用程序中跟踪用户会话状态的机制。它是一个用于存储和获取与特定用户相关的数据的对象。
    HttpSession的作用包括...

  • 怎么在java里实例化一个对象

    要在Java中实例化一个对象,需要按照以下步骤进行操作: 创建一个类:首先,需要创建一个类来定义对象的属性和行为。类是描述对象的模板,它包含了对象的属性(成...